Continuing Education

Every CRFAR graduate is required to obtain 15 hours of retiree-financial specific continuing education towards their annual renewal.

CRFA™ Continuing Education (CE) is a re-certification process and therefore the courses you take should be directly linked to the knowledge, skills, and abilities covered in the original training class. Retiree  specific issues taken from the various areas within the financial planning discipline are the focus of the CRFA™.

In addition, we have links to several providers that offer courses in retiree specific topics that are approved for CRFA™ Continuing Education. Most of these courses also qualify for PACE or CFP® credit.

Disciplinary Publication

 

SCRFA members must maintain their level of competency through continuing education.  They must also agree to continue to abide by the Code of Ethics, a primary agreement for elite advisors, and continue to provide objective recommendations.  The following link provides the public with the forms to file a complaint and the options available to the member.  If the Society agrees that the member has violated their rules of ethics, the publication also contains the disciplinary actions the Society will take against the member.

2009 Job Analysis

SCRFA engaged the firm of Schroder Measurement Technologies, Inc. to perform a Job Analysis.  The analysis was designed to develop a certification examination program meeting the standards established in The Joint Standards for Educational and Psychological Testing (AERA< APA< and NCME, 1999) Standards 14.10 and 14.14. 

The anlaysis consisted of a survey that was posted on-line.  Individuals in the financial advisory services responded by identifying the topics they considered essential to retirement.  Their responses were mapped to the existing question data base.  Where there were deficiencies, SMEs participated in writing new questions.
